Summary

Balfour Beatty is seeking a Safety Coordinator in Charlotte to support field operations for our Carolinas Division. This role assists in implementing Balfour Beatty’s Zero Harm® program by providing jobsite-level safety support, documentation, training assistance, and daily collaboration with project teams. The Safety Coordinator serves as a key liaison between the project site and the Safety leadership team, helping ensure safe work practices, regulatory compliance, and proactive hazard mitigation.

This position is ideal for an early-career safety professional who excels in field presence, communication, and accurate documentation.

Essential Functions
  • Support implementation of project safety plans and Zero Harm® initiatives.
  • Coordinate with project teams to maintain safe work practices and site compliance.
  • Conduct routine jobsite walkthroughs, identify hazards, and track corrective actions.
  • Maintain safety signage, bulletin boards, and first-aid/safety equipment.
  • Assist with new-hire safety orientation and basic task-specific training.
  • Maintain toolbox talk logs, meeting minutes, and training attendance.
  • Assist with first aid response, incident documentation, and basic investigation steps.
  • Participate in regulatory inspections and help ensure prompt correction of violations.
  • Maintain organized safety files, inspection reports, and OSHA-related documentation.
  • Prepare periodic safety summaries for project teams and Safety leadership.
Minimum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in Safety & Environmental Health, Construction Management, or related field; or equivalent field experience.
  • 2–4 years of construction or industrial safety experience preferred.
  • OSHA 10 required; OSHA 30 strongly preferred.
  • Ability to recognize hazards, communicate effectively, and maintain accurate documentation.
  • Strong interpersonal and customer service skills.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office, email, and basic digital reporting tools.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ced field environment and uphold Balfour Beatty safety values.
Preferred Experience
  • Experience assisting with incident investigations or regulatory inspections.
  • Experience providing basic first aid or emergency response.
